Where Does This Term Come From?

The term "snow bunny" has been around for a while, actually, longer than TikTok itself. It traditionally referred to someone who goes to ski resorts, perhaps more for the social scene than for serious skiing. This older meaning often carried a slight hint of someone who is new to skiing or not very skilled, but still enjoying the mountain atmosphere.

On TikTok, the phrase has taken on a slightly different, more general meaning. It is less about skiing ability and more about the overall winter aesthetic. The platform has helped popularize it as a broader fashion and lifestyle trend. It is like the term got a fresh coat of snow, if you will, for the internet age.

Is the "Snow Bunny" Term Always Positive?

The term "snow bunny" on TikTok is mostly used in a fun, fashion-focused way, but it is good to know that it has had different meanings in the past. Like many slang terms, its interpretation can change depending on who is using it and in what context. It is something to keep in mind, you know.

Historically, the phrase sometimes carried a slightly negative or dismissive tone. It could refer to someone perceived as being at a ski resort more for show or for seeking attention, rather than for the sport itself. This older usage might still be present for some people, basically.

However, on TikTok, the term has largely been reappropriated to describe a winter aesthetic that is generally seen as cute and stylish. Most users today use it without any negative intent. It is important to be aware of these different layers of meaning, though, as a matter of fact.
